Home >> Swiss Lenana Mount Hotel

Swiss Lenana Mount Hotel

Ralph Bunche, Kilimani, Nairobi, Kenya,Kilimani,Nairobi,Silesian

Swiss Lenana Mount HotelOver view
All Photos

Facilities

Opening

  • Opened: 2017; Renovated: 2024; Number of Rooms: 140

Hotel Photos

Swiss Lenana Mount Hotel

Ralph Bunche, Kilimani, Nairobi, Kenya,Kilimani,Nairobi,Silesian